多DAG任务高可靠性调度算法研究

来源 :华中科技大学 | 被引量 : 0次 | 上传用户:midou2000
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
云环境下的调度算法一直是研究的热点,目前对于单DAG任务的研究比较多,算法也比较成熟,但是对于多DAG任务,由于任务的到达时间具有随机性,因此无法使用单DAG任务的调度算法直接调度。另外,大多数的DAG任务调度算法只考虑处理机的性能、带宽、任务的计算代价等因素,而不考虑可靠性因素对任务执行时间的影响。但是由于云计算系统硬件规模庞大,软件系统复杂,所以,任务执行过程中的可靠性也成为影响任务最早完成时间的一个重要因素。为了提高任务执行过程中的可靠性并对随机达到的多个DAG任务进行调度,提出了两个算法即基于任务复制的高可靠调度(HRSA)算法和基于任务复制的多DAG任务高可靠性调度(HRSAMD)算法。HRSA算法通过主动复制的方式,将任务和它的多个备份任务公平地映射到多个处理机上,从而提高任务执行过程中的可靠性。相对于已有的备份数量下限算法,该算法在分配处理机时更加公平,能够在满足用户可靠性需求的同时更高效地对DAG任务进行调度。HRSAMD算法是动态调度算法,它能够动态地处理任意时刻随机到达的多个DAG任务。HRSAMD算法能够将DAG任务动态地拆分为无约束关系的节点,然后利用HRSA算法对节点进行多副本任务调度,从而提高DAG任务执行过程中的可靠性,满足用户的可靠性需求。实验表明,HRSA算法与现有算法相比,调度完成相同的任务集耗时更短,而HRSAMD算法能够在满足用户的可靠性需求的同时,有效的降低任务的最早完成时间。
其他文献
多属性群决策是决策管理领域的重要研究内容,在工程管理、项目评估、企业招标和经济规划等诸多方面有着广泛应用.由于决策环境的复杂性和专家知识结构的有限性等使得决策信息
春季万物复苏,细菌也容易滋生,是禽类疾病多发的季节,由于多种候鸟迁移,给养鸡户造成一定困扰.可能造成禽流感、新城疫等疾病的发生和大范围流行。处理不好,可能会给养殖业带来一定
为满足经济增长对交通运输的需要,国家高速公路扩容改造建设迫在眉睫,针对沥青铳刨料问题,厂拌沥青冷再生技术在高速公路改扩建中伴有重要丝角色。本文通过查找文献,在现场施
针对绥中县小型生猪养殖户存在的问题,从选址、猪舍建设、环境控制、防疫、用药等方面提供技术指导。
笔者根据多年深入基层采写稿件的心得和工作体会,以讲好兴安老区故事,展现兴安良好形象为主题,从传承红色基因、突出产业发展、注重改善民生三个方面,论述怎样才能讲好兴安盟
一个时代有一个时代的故事,进入新时代,习近平总书记要求文艺工作者要讲好中国故事,传播好中国声音。近些年,传统电视媒体一直在强调节目要讲故事,但是怎样讲好故事,许多新闻
随着智能手持终端的普及,微信已经成为现今最重要的社交工具.利用互联网、云技术、微信、微博等,拓展传播途径、增强传播力也是电视媒体发展的要求.本文介绍了内蒙古广播电视
新媒体高速发展,其在信息传播方面具有先天优势:传播范围广、传播速度快、形式多元化,极大地满足了受众的需求。电视民生新闻一直以其贴近性、平民化深受受众喜爱。新媒体的出
乙未割台之际,著名诗人易顺鼎为保台积极奔走。他不仅前后多次上书要求拒绝议和,还两度亲赴台南,支持黑旗军等台湾军民抗敌。直到日军攻陷台南,他还在与友人恽祖祁等为台湾筹
网络传播的移动视听APP具有数量多、更新速度快、制作背景复杂、传播渠道多样、影响范围广等特点。本文讨论基于云计算架构设计,由云爬虫、页面分析、分级预警、数据发布与存